EXERCISE 3.3

1. Solve the following pair of linear equations by the elimination method and the substitution method:

(i) x + y = 5 and 2x – 3y = 4

(ii) 3x + 4y = 10 and 2x – 2y = 2

(iii) 3x – 5y – 4 = 0 and 9x = 2y + 7

(iv) x/2 + 2y/3 = -1 and x – y/3 = 3

(v) 3y/2 – 5x/3 = -2 and y/3 + x/3 = 13/16

(vi) x – y = 3 and x/3 + y/2 = 6

2. Form the pair of linear equations in the following problems, and find their solutions (if they exist) by the elimination method:

(i) If we add 1 to the numerator and subtract 1 from the denominator, a fraction reduces to 1. It becomes 1/2 if we only add 1 to the denominator. What is the fraction?

(ii) Five years ago, Nur was thrice as old as Sonu. Ten years later, Nur will be twice as old as Sonu. How old are Nur and Sonu?

(iii) The sum of the digits of a two-digit number is 9. Also, nine times this number is twice the number obtained by reversing the order of the digits. Find the number.

(iv) Meena went to a bank to withdraw Rs 2000. She asked the cashier to give her Rs 50 and Rs 100 notes only. Meena got 25 notes in all. Find how many notes of Rs 50 and Rs 100 she received.

(v) A lending library has a fixed charge for the first three days and an additional charge for each day thereafter. Saritha paid Rs 27 for a book kept for seven days, while Susy paid Rs 21 for the book she kept for five days. Find the fixed charge and the charge for each extra day.

3. The monthly incomes of A and B are in the ratio of 9:7 and their monthly expenditures are in the ratio of 4:3. If each saves Rs. 1600 per month, find the monthly income of each.

4. The students of a class are made to stand in rows. If 3 students are extra in a row, there would be 1 row less. If 3 students are less in a row, there would be 2 rows more. Find the number of students in the class.

5. A and B each have certain numbers of mangoes. A says to B, ‘if you give me 30 of your mangoes, I will have twice as many as left with you.’ B replies, ‘if you give me 10, I will have thrice as many as left with you.’ How many mangoes does each have?

6. If the pair of equations x + ay = b and ax + y = 1 has infinitely many solutions, then choose the correct option from the given alternatives:

(i) a = 1, b = 1

(ii) a = -1, b = -1

(iii) a = 1, b = -1

(iv) a = -1, b = 1

* (a) Both (i) and (iii) are true

* (b) Both (ii) and (iv) are true

* (c) Both (i) and (ii) are true

* (d) Both (iii) and (iv) are true

7. For what value of K, the following pair of linear equations has infinite number of solutions?

kx + 3y – (k – 3) = 0

12x + ky – k = 0

(a) k = -6

(b) k = 4

(c) k = -4

(d) k = 6

8. Following are the steps of solving a word problem of the linear equation in two variables. Choose the correct sequence from the given options:

(i) Represent the unknowns using variables.

(ii) Solve the equations.

(iii) Form the required equations.

(iv) Interpret the result.

(a) (i) -> (ii) -> (iii) -> (iv)

(b) (i) -> (iii) -> (ii) -> (iv)

(c) (iv) -> (iii) -> (ii) -> (i)

(d) (ii) -> (i) -> (iii) -> (iv)

9. Solve the following pair of linear equations:

(i)

2/x + 3/y = 2

4/x – 9/y = -1

(ii)

1/(2x) + 1/(3y) = 2

1/(3x) + 1/(2y) = 13/6

(iii)

5/(x-1) + 1/(y-2) = 2

6/(x-1) – 3/(y-2) = 1

10. In a two digit number, the sum of the digit is 9. If the digits are reversed, the number is increased by 9. Find the number.

11. The sum of the digits of a two digit number is 15. The number decreased by 27 if the digits are reversed. Find the number.

12. The difference between two numbers is 4. Twice the smaller number added to three times the larger number gives 82. Find the two numbers.
